Payroll Office

Begin your journey through the museum in the former payroll office for the Nevada Northern Railway. Here visitors will learn about the mining booms in White Pine County and the contruction of the Nevada Northern Railway. Shortly after the railroad building was completed in 1906, the town’s population more than doubled as people flocked to Ely.
On display are original records, mimeographs, and adding machines.
